Output 198bfc49b425b0ff4e3dbc164de00d5fa40e9f8a39fe1fb43ba78ea64a4a67f2:1

value
41885808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f376a1bde02428ed5ec86bd3977227bde3881b OP_EQUAL
address
3BMEXpWTzfQNrkxcEvmcFWaNBQkFc4wqNj
transaction
198bfc49b425b0ff4e3dbc164de00d5fa40e9f8a39fe1fb43ba78ea64a4a67f2
confirmations
359478
spent
true